
Richard Learoyd
May 29 @ 10:00 am - August 9 @ 5:00 pm

Fraenkel Gallery is pleased to present an exhibition of new and recent photographs by Richard Learoyd. Exploring classical subjects using exacting photographic techniques, Learoyd creates hyper-detailed works with enigmatic depths. Highlights include new studies of ancient trees printed on gessoed canvas and largescale views of the Grand Canyon. The show also features new still lifes, and marks the debut of photographs Learoyd made in collaboration with renowned ceramicist Frances Palmer. For the exhibition, Palmer created vessels based on drawings made by Learoyd, who in turn photographed the ceramics in his studio, overflowing with flowers in a reconsideration of Rococo styles.
